Create Everyday Card - Instructions:

  • Create card base from Peaches & Cream cardstock (finished card is 4.25” X 4.25”), adhere panel of printed paper to card front.
  • Sponge Cool Pool ink to 3” X 3” square of Whip Cream cardstock (stay in center of square).
  • Stamp terrarium with Black Licorice ink over inked area of panel and then stamp succulent and small floral on additional piece of Whip Cream cardstock, color with markers of your choice and detail cut.
  • Adhere detail cut images over terrarium with foam adhesive and also pop up sentiment sticker.
  • Mat panel with Whip Cream cardstock and adhere to card front

Hello Sunshine Card - Instructions:

  • Create card base from Whip Cream cardstock (4.25” X 5.5” finished card size)
  • Adhere panel of printed paper to card front (4” X 5.25”)
  • Die cut circle from Journey Vellum; die cut scallop circle from Whip Cream cardstock using Journey Scallops.
  • Adhere vellum and cardstock die cut to card front using foam adhesive
  • Affix butterfly sticker to die cut and pop up sentiment sticker with foam adhesive
